Understanding Delta Codeshare Partnerships
Codeshare agreements are common in the airline industry, enabling airlines to sell seats on flights operated by their partners. For passengers, this expands travel options and often provides seamless booking experiences through a single airline’s channels. Delta’s codeshare partners are carefully selected to extend their network and offer customers broader access to destinations, often including smaller or regional airports. These partnerships are particularly advantageous for loyalty program members, as they often allow for earning miles and status benefits on partner flights, just as they would on flights operated directly by Delta.
Delta and Cape Air: A Partnership for SkyMiles Members
The collaboration between Delta Air Lines and Cape Air provides SkyMiles members with a valuable opportunity to earn rewards on specific Cape Air flights. This partnership applies to select Cape Air flights arriving at or departing from key airports such as Boston Logan International (BOS), San Juan, PR (SJU), St. Thomas, USVI (STT), St. Croix, USVI (STX), and Billings, MT (BIL). To be eligible for SkyMiles benefits, these flights must be purchased through Delta channels, meaning they are marketed and operated by Cape Air but ticketed by Delta. This ensures that your SkyMiles account is properly credited for your travel.
Earning SkyMiles on Cape Air Flights
When flying on Cape Air flights booked through Delta, SkyMiles members earn miles as they would on Delta-marketed flights. For Cape Air-marketed (flight numbers including the “9K” airline code) and Delta-ticketed (ticket number starting with “006”) flights, mileage accrual is based on the ticket price. Members earn 5 miles per U.S. Dollar spent on the base fare and carrier-imposed surcharges, excluding government taxes and fees. Furthermore, Medallion members receive bonus miles based on their status: Silver members earn a total of 7 miles per dollar, Gold members earn 8, Platinum members earn 9, and Diamond members earn an impressive 11 miles per dollar. These bonus miles significantly boost your SkyMiles balance, helping you reach award travel faster.
Earning Medallion Qualification Dollars (MQDs)
In addition to SkyMiles, flights with Delta Codeshare Partners like Cape Air also contribute to your Medallion Status qualification. SkyMiles members earn Medallion Qualification Dollars (MQDs) on eligible Cape Air flights, just as they do on Delta-marketed flights. MQDs are earned based on your spending on Delta-ticketed flights, including the base fare and carrier surcharges, but not government-imposed taxes and fees. This means that choosing Cape Air flights booked via Delta not only increases your SkyMiles balance but also helps you progress towards or maintain your desired Medallion Status, unlocking further benefits within the SkyMiles program.
Booking and Eligibility for Delta Codeshare Partner Benefits
To ensure you receive SkyMiles and MQDs for your Cape Air flights, it is crucial to book your travel through delta.com or any Delta-authorized sales channel. The qualifying electronic ticket for eligible Cape Air flights must be issued on Delta (006) ticket stock. During the booking process, ensure you include your SkyMiles account number in the Delta reservation record. This will allow for automatic crediting of miles after you travel. If you forget to add your SkyMiles number before your flight, you can request retroactive credit within 9 months of completing your travel.
It’s important to note that certain tickets are not eligible for mileage accrual on Cape Air flights, including bulk fares, consolidator vacation packages, tour packages, Award Tickets, and Pay with Miles tickets. Always verify the fare rules when booking to confirm mileage eligibility.
